MAX4782ETE+T Description

MAX4782ETE+T Description

The MAX4782ETE+T is a high-performance, low-leakage, dual 4:1 multiplexer/demultiplexer integrated circuit (IC) designed for demanding applications requiring minimal signal distortion and high reliability. Manufactured by Analog Devices Inc./Maxim Integrated, this IC is part of the MAX4782 series and is housed in a 16-TQFN surface-mount package, making it suitable for compact and high-density designs.

MAX4782ETE+T Features

  • Low Leakage Current: The MAX4782ETE+T boasts a maximum leakage current (IS(off)) of just 2nA, ensuring minimal power consumption and signal degradation when channels are off.
  • Superior Channel Matching: With a channel-to-channel matching (ΔRon) of 300mOhm, this IC provides consistent performance across multiple channels, making it ideal for applications requiring precise signal routing.
  • Low On-State Resistance: The maximum on-state resistance (Ron) of 1Ohm ensures minimal signal attenuation and power loss, enhancing overall system efficiency.
  • Fast Switching Times: The MAX4782ETE+T offers fast switch times with a maximum turn-on time (Ton) of 25ns and turn-off time (Toff) of 15ns, enabling rapid signal switching without compromising signal integrity.
  • Low Channel Capacitance: The channel capacitance (CS(off), CD(off)) is rated at 38pF and 158pF, respectively, minimizing signal delay and ensuring high-frequency performance.
  • Wide Supply Voltage Range: The IC operates over a wide supply voltage range of 1.6V to 3.6V, providing flexibility in power supply design and compatibility with various systems.
  • Compliance and Reliability: The MAX4782ETE+T is REACH unaffected and RoHS3 compliant, ensuring environmental safety and regulatory compliance. Additionally, it has a moisture sensitivity level (MSL) of 1, making it suitable for a wide range of manufacturing processes.
